Title: Maryland Sample Letter for Complaint to Close Estate — Request to Forward to Brothers Introduction: In Maryland, when dealing with the closure of an estate, it is essential to follow the proper legal procedures. This detailed sample letter for complaint aims to request the forwarding of estate documents to brothers for their review and potential contribution to resolving any remaining estate matters. Let's explore the various types of Maryland sample letters for complaints to close estates and request forwarding them to brothers. 1. Maryland Sample Letter for Complaint to Close Estate — Request for Document Review: This type of letter is used when requesting brothers to review the estate-related documents, including the will, inventory, and outstanding liabilities. It urges them to contribute their insights and take appropriate action towards closing the estate effectively. 2. Maryland Sample Letter for Complaint to Close Estate — Request for Mandatory Meeting: In some cases, it may be necessary to hold a meeting among the brothers to discuss the progress and closure of the estate formally. This letter can be used to request their presence and emphasize the importance of their involvement in settling the estate matters. 3. Maryland Sample Letter for Complaint to Close Estate — Request for Financial Contributions: When estate obligations surpass available assets, a letter requesting brothers to contribute financially may be necessary. This type of letter outlines the financial situation, provides an opportunity for siblings to discuss their willingness to contribute, and seeks a resolution for addressing the estate's outstanding debts or expenses. 4. Maryland Sample Letter for Complaint to Close Estate — Request for Mediation or Arbitration: In cases where disagreements or disputes arise regarding the estate's distribution, a letter requesting mediation or arbitration can be sent to brothers. This letter aims to initiate a process that helps resolve conflicts and achieve a fair distribution while closing the estate smoothly. 5. Maryland Sample Letter for Complaint to Close Estate — Requesting Legal Assistance: If legal complexities hinder the estate closure process, this letter can serve as a request to brothers for seeking legal assistance. It provides an overview of the legal challenges faced, suggests consulting an attorney, and emphasizes the need for their cooperation to resolve the estate's outstanding legal matters. Conclusion: These types of Maryland sample letters demonstrate the variety of ways siblings can request their brothers' involvement in the estate closure process. Whether it's reviewing documents, attending meetings, contributing financially, or seeking legal assistance, these letters help establish clear communication channels, encourage cooperation, and facilitate a just resolution in closing the estate.
